Abstract

In this paper the authors discuss how multiple upcoming axion experiments can be coordinated to extract additional information through interferometry. If dark matter is a sufficiently light axion-like particle, it's macroscopic wavelength could allow two (or more) detectors to determine the local dark matter velocity, a potentially important consideration for the design of these searches.
